Chapter 1: Sleep Interrupted
The sound of a blaring alarm woke all the Titans from the slumber they were enjoying. Robin whimpered as he looked at his clock. Only 3:10 AM. Grumpily, everyone quickly dressed into their uniforms and met in the living room to asses the situation.
"Alright, everybody," Robin said, still yawning. "According to this, uh...HIVE just broke into a jewelry store in the mall and the downtown bank. Plasmus knocked off the jewelry store, and Jinx and Cinderblock broke into the bank and are heading back toward their hideout. Raven, Cyborg, and I will take care of Jinx and CB. Star and BB can go after that moving slimeball Plasmus. Titans, go!"
Still sleepy, Beast Boy changed into a hawk and followed Starfire as they flew toward the downtown mall to catch Plasmus. Meanwhile, Cyborg and Raven used the T-Car and Robin followed on his motorcycle in pursuit of Jinx's and Cinderblock's escape vehicle.
Starfire arrived just in time to see Plasmus trying to ooze through the sewer and fire a large starbolt at him, knocking him into a thousand slimy pieces; however, she screamed with annoyance as the all just came together again. Beast Boy followed close behind and turned into a giant mammoth in a desperate attempt to squash Plasmus. But he just oozed out from under him and knocked him several hundred feet back by changing his flexible arm into a giant club and dealing Beast Boy a stunning blow to the head. Dizzily, he staggered back on his feet. "Star, this isn't working. We have to think of something else!"
Meanwhile, the T-Car and Robin's motorcycle were in hot pursuit of the other getaway vehicle. Pulling back on the handlebars, Robin increased his speed until his was right alongside it. Seeing this, Jinx swerved the car toward him, forcing Robin to turn left and ride his motorcycle on the narrow sidewalk. "Damn! She's gonna squash Robin right against a building like some damn fly! Do something with yo powers, Rae!" Cyborg was beside himself. Opening her door, Raven flew onto the roof and looked around quickly for something to use. All the while the car drew ever closer to Robin, threatening to knock him into one of the tall city skyscrapers.
Now it was mere feet away. Jinx smirked evily. "Look's like you're out of luck, you— however, she was cut short as their car suddenly started to shake madly. She looked out of the window, and the boy on the motorcycle was growing smaller and smaller by the moment. They were rising into the air! Raven, standing on top of the T-Car, concentrated all her power into levitating the vehicle up into the sky. "Cy, call the SWAT team and tell them to wait in front of the police station. We're going to pay them a little visit," Raven said in her monotone. Still on the motorcycle, Robin yelled his thanks to Raven, who simply nodded in return.
Back outside the mall, Starfire and Beast Boy, while greatly delaying his progress, had failed in their attempt to apprehend Plasmus. "This is not working, friend! We must think of another way to capture our foe Plasmus!" Starfire yelled to Beast Boy, while still continuing a merciless assault of starbolts on Plasmus. But her energy wouldn't last forever, and Beast Boy knew it. Glancing over at the river, an idea suddenly popped into his head. Grabbing the two bags of stolen jewelry, Beast Boy started to sprint toward the half-frozen river, shouting back taunts and insults at Plasmus. Just as he expected, Plasmus began to pursue him. Changing into a cheetah, Beast Boy beat Plasmus to the river, standing dangerously close to the edge and making sneering faces at Plasmus. Blinded with rage, Plasmus continued to sprint stupidly toward Beast Boy, with Starfire following overhead. Plasmus was coming closer and closer, and just when it looked like he was about to grab Beast Boy, he dropped the two bags of stolen jewelry in his jaw, changed into a bat, and flew into the air and out of the way. Unable to stop himself, Plasmus's momentum caused him to stumble over the bags and fly toward the river, given a little nudge by Starfire's starbolt. A loud splash was heard, followed a few seconds later by a giant ice block with a frozen Plasmus inside it. Not even he could withstand the cold of the freezing December water.
Beast Boy and Starfire exhaled with relief, and a few minutes later the T- Car and Robin on his motorcycle turned the corner and screeched to a halt in front of the river. They all exited and Robin asked, "Are you two okay?" Starfire and BB nodded.
"Yeah, we're fine, and we got Plasmus," Beast Boy replied. "How about you guys?"
"We're all okay, thanks to Raven. She got Jinx and Cinderblock and we had them put in the maximum security prison just out of town. Whew, now that we're done, what do you all say we—
But a large amount of smoke that suddenly surrounded them did not allow Robin to finish his sentence. Coughing, Robin saw a bright red light engulfing them, followed by the screams of Starfire and Raven. Blinded, Robin was knocked to the ground and forced to turn away and listen to the screams of his teammates. After several seconds, the light and sound subsided, and Robin could finally look up. Cyborg had leapt onto Beast Boy, forcing him back. Raven's body lay on the ground, her clothes ripped and smoldering. However, there was no sign of Starfire. Robin felt a deep coldness inside his chest. Was Raven alive? And where was Star? He saw Beast Boy and Cyborg stirring, and heard the mumble, "Man, what the hell was that?"
It took a few minutes for Beast Boy to take in what had just happened. "Oh my god! Raven! Are you alright?!" He did not receive a response. Robin, however, was so shocked by the whole thing he could hardly move. Tears filled inside his mask and streamed down his face. He hadn't ever cried about anything, but he couldn't help himself. Starfire was probably dead, and God knew if Raven was alive. The last thing he heard before darkness enveloped him was, "Quick, somebody call an ambulance!"
